Brandon Weston writes about Ozarkan folkways in new book

Brandon Weston, a native Ozarker, explores and writes about Ozark folkways. Weston has written several books and articles, including Ozark Folk Magic: Plants, Prayer & Healing and the just-released Granny Thornapple’s Book of Charms: Magic and Folklore From the Ozark Mountains. He visited the Carver Center for Public Radio to discuss his writings and inspiration.
